KASA is proud to be a certified women-owned and micro-business.Responsibilities include but are not limited to : -Safely operate a variety of heavy machinery, including excavators, dozers, backhoes, skid steers, skip loaders, wheel loaders, and motor graders.

  • Perform daily inspections and minor repairs on equipment to ensure safe and efficient operation.-Utilize GPS, base, and rover systems to accurately interpret grading plans and manage elevations.
  • Work with grading and trench teams to ensure precise cuts, fills, and installation of pipes.-Follow all safety procedures and regulations to maintain a safe work environment, prioritizing the well-being of yourself and your team.
  • Execute mass grading and trenching, paying close attention to underground utilities such as wires and pipes.-Collaborate with landscaping teams for grading tasks related to site preparation and project completion.
  • Complete project tasks efficiently while maintaining high-quality standards and meeting project deadlines.The ideal candidate should possess : -Proven experience and proficiency in operating a wide variety of heavy equipment.
  • Strong understanding of GPS systems and how to apply them in construction work.-Knowledge of grading plans, elevations, cuts, fills, and other technical aspects of site work.
  • Familiarity with safety regulations and a commitment to enforcing and following them on all projects.-Experience working with trench teams, mass grading, and pipe installation.
  • Ability to identify and avoid potential hazards such as wires, pipes, and other underground utilities.-Excellent communication skills and the ability to work well within a team.
